Output d99ffb489a8baaa8eb27e26b2e05a0787289226e9e48618514e64f37daa78420:1

value
1277792197
script pubkey
OP_0 OP_PUSHBYTES_20 8fb325bad3c5fb7da5b30d4bf64f07a026176f6a
address
bc1q37ejtwknchahmfdnp49lvnc85qnpwmm2ch8g0x
transaction
d99ffb489a8baaa8eb27e26b2e05a0787289226e9e48618514e64f37daa78420
confirmations
298369
spent
true